Linux命令行服务器开发是构建高效、稳定后端服务的重要方式。通过命令行工具,开发者可以快速搭建环境、调试代码并部署应用。
常用的开源工具如Git、Make、CMake和Docker,能够显著提升开发效率。Git用于版本控制,确保代码变更可追溯;Make和CMake帮助自动化编译过程,减少手动操作。
Shell脚本在服务器开发中同样不可或缺。通过编写简单的脚本,可以实现自动化部署、日志分析和系统监控,提高运维效率。
使用像tmux或screen这样的终端复用工具,可以让开发者在同一个终端中管理多个任务,避免因网络中断导致的工作丢失。

AI生成内容,仅供参考
服务器性能优化方面,Linux提供了丰富的工具,如top、htop、iostat和netstat。这些工具能帮助开发者实时监控系统资源使用情况。
开源社区为Linux服务器开发提供了大量现成的工具和库,开发者可以通过包管理器如apt、yum或dnf快速安装所需软件。
掌握Linux命令行不仅是技术要求,更是提升开发效率的关键。通过合理利用开源工具,开发者可以更专注于业务逻辑,而非重复性操作。